What is Sales Tax in Bear Lake?

Sales tax in Bear Lake is a consumption tax imposed on the sale of goods and services. It is collected by the seller at the point of sale and passed on to the government. The sales tax rate in Bear Lake Idaho varies depending on the type of goods or services being sold and the applicable state and local tax laws. Businesses are responsible for collecting and remitting the correct amount of sales tax to the authorities.

Sales Taxable and Exempt Items in Bear Lake

In Bear Lake, certain items are subject to sales tax, while others are exempt. Understanding which items fall into each category is crucial for compliance:

  • Taxable Items:Clothing, electronics, and household goods are generally subject to Bear Lake sales tax.
  • Exempt Items:Prescription medications, certain food items, and agricultural products are typically exempt from sales tax in Bear Lake.

How Sales Tax is Calculated in Bear Lake

The calculation of sales tax in Bear Lake involves applying the Bear Lake sales tax rate to the purchase price of taxable goods and services. Businesses often use a Bear Lake sales tax calculator to ensure accuracy in their calculations. The sales tax rate in Bear Lake Idaho is a combination of state and local rates, which can vary.

Common Misconceptions about Sales Tax in Bear Lake

There are several misconceptions about sales tax Bear Lake that can lead to compliance issues. One common myth is that all online purchases are exempt from sales tax, which is not true if the seller has a nexus in Bear Lake. Another misconception is that sales tax applies uniformly across all goods and services, ignoring exemptions.

Affiliate Nexus in Bear Lake: What it Means for Businesses

Affiliate nexus refers to the connection a business has with Bear Lake through affiliates, which can require the business to collect Bear Lake ID sales tax. If a business has affiliates in Bear Lake, it may be obligated to collect and remit sales tax on sales made to Bear Lake residents.

Where to Apply for a Sales Tax Permit in Bear Lake

Businesses must apply for a sales tax permit to legally collect sales tax in Bear Lake. This can be done through the state’s Department of Revenue website, ensuring that businesses comply with local tax laws.

Idaho State Income Tax Rates & Brackets for 2023

The following tables represents Idaho's income tax rates and tax brackets:

SINGLE FILER

Brackets

Rates

$0 - $1,588

1.00%

$1,588 - $4,763

3.00%

$4,763 - $7,939

4.50%

$7,939+

6.00%

MARRIED FILING JOINTLY

Brackets

Rates

$0 - $3,176

1.00%

$3,176 - $9,526

3.00%

$9,526 - $15,878

4.50%

$15,878+

6.00%

Filing Status

Standard Deduction Amt.

Single

$12,950

Couple

$19,425
